Cain had moved into the true crime genre. --Jack Olsen, author of Hastened to the Grave One of the those books that won't let go...I defy anyone to get halfway and put it down. --Darcy O'Brien, author of Murder in Little Egypt A story filled with dark truths about ourselves and our neighbors. --Carlton Stowers, author of Careless Whispers Author InformationTHOMAS FRENCH has been a journalist for three decades. For most of that time, he worked as a reporter at the St. Petersburg Times, where he was awarded a Pulitzer Prize for feature writing. He now teaches journalism at Indiana University.
